The Impact of Student Loans on the Economy

Student loans have become a large part of the financial burden on many students. The Education Department estimates that the total amount of student loan debt is over one trillion dollars. The problem that they are trying to address is how to help more students get the funding they need to start their careers.

Student loans are a major issue in the United States. It’s not just that they can be difficult to repay, but student loans can also prevent young people from starting their own businesses or purchasing a home. All of this is bad for the economy because it delays their ability to start contributing to society.
